    Invisible files - can't get access


    I have G disk with no files visible on it, but when I check it with any antivirus I do see my photos and documents I've missed.

    How could such problem be solved?

    I would use a live linux cd and mount the drive and view it, I can't be 100 % sure, but I have a feeling your stuff would show up. Perhaps I can point you in the right direction as I don't know your linux skill set I will suggest Kubuntu | Friendly Computing if you have any questions about how to mount a hard drive, feel free to ask, if I am still not sleeping I will surely answer them. Also, you will need to gran an .iso image from that site, and burn it using something like cdburnerxp (pick the version without opencandy)
